Distribution Center Slated For Woodbury Properties

Rockefeller Group paid $21.2 million for industrial and office buildings on adjoining lands near the Seaford-Oyster Bay Expressway.

WOODBURY, NY – Rockefeller Group paid $21.2 million for two adjoining properties with a collective nine acres and two buildings that will serve as a new warehouse and distribution center.

According to Long Island Business News, the Manhattan-based real estate firm paid RXR Realty $10.2 million for a six acres and a 50,559-square foot office building at 1 Media Crossways.

The firm also purchased the neighboring three-acre property and 10,291-square-foot industrial building, at 200 Crossways Park Drive West, from E&M Logistics for $11 million.

The properties are a short distance from the Seaford-Oyster Bay Expressway.
